| | Surname | Grant | | | Rank, Orders, Etc. | Vice-Adml. C.B. | | | First Name | Henry Duncan | | | Family, Career, Home, Clubs | S. of late J.Grant, Paymaster R.N. b. 1834. m. 1859, Agnes, dau. of late Commdr. W.V.Lee, R.N. In Baltic and in gunboat ""Thistle"" at bombardt. of Sweaborg 1854-5. In "" Pearl's "" Brigade during Indian Mutiny 1857-9. Commd. ''Serapis"" 1870-3,""Triumph"" 1874-5. �Aurora"" and ""Narcissus"" 1875-8. A.D.C. to the Queen 1878-81. Adm-Supt. of Devonport Dockyard 1885-8. |
